How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hendersonville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hendersonville Studio Apartments | $1,237 | $1,000 | $1,475 |
| Hendersonville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,478 | $1,089 | $1,875 |
| Hendersonville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,726 | $1,225 | $2,349 |
| Hendersonville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,994 | $1,650 | $2,750 |
| Hendersonville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,700 | $3,700 | $3,700 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Hendersonville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Hendersonville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Hendersonville is $1,623.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Hendersonville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Hendersonville is a 1,307 square feet unit starting from $1,350 at Charleston at the Meadows.
What is the average size for Hendersonville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Hendersonville is currently at 628 sq ft.
